A Kala Phundava style of painting created using water colour. Man is in jama, kamarband and mukut. Ladies are in ghagra, choli and odhani. Picture shows a couple seated on a carpet inside a pavilion. They are talking to a lady seated before them. One female attendant stands on either side. Below two persons are seen playing on musical instruments. A third person is seated holding a horse.
